Job Description
Role Description
We are seeking a skilled Remote Medical Coder to join our team on a part-time basis. As a Remote Medical Coder, you will be responsible for accurately assigning medical codes to patient records, ensuring compliance with coding guidelines and regulations. This is a remote position, allowing you to work from the comfort of your own home.
- Review and accurately assign medical codes to patient records using ICD-10 and CPT coding systems
- Ensure all codes are in compliance with coding guidelines and regulations
- Work closely with healthcare providers to clarify any coding discrepancies
- Maintain a thorough understanding of medical terminology, procedures, and diagnoses
- Keep up-to-date with changes in coding guidelines and regulations
- Meet productivity and quality standards set by the company
- Maintain patient confidentiality and adhere to HIPAA regulations
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ent required; Associate's degree in Health Information Management or related field preferred
- Certified Professional Coder (CPC) or Certified Coding Specialist (CCS) certification required
- Minimum of 2 years of medical coding experience, preferably in a chiropractic setting
- Proficient in ICD-10 and CPT coding systems
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y
- Excellent organizational and time management skills
- Ability to work independently and meet deadlines
- Comfortable working remotely and using electronic medical records systems
- Knowledge of HIPAA regulations and patient confidentiality
Contract Details
This is a part-time, remote position with flexible hours. The contract will be for an initial period of 6 months, with the possibility of extension based on performance.
